Duties and Responsibilities

Assist residents with daily living activities as a Certified Nursing Assistant (CNA), including bathing, grooming, toileting, and dressing

Serve meals, assist with feeding, and provide water and nourishment between meals

Support residents with mobility, including ambulating, turning, and positioning

Monitor and document vital signs, weight, intake, and output

Ensure resident comfort and respond promptly to call lights and requests

Report changes in resident condition to the nursing supervisor

Maintain accurate documentation of care provided and resident observations

Uphold resident privacy and dignity in accordance with HIPAA and facility standards

Comply with all federal, state, and facility regulations and guidelines

Stay current through educational opportunities and maintaining CNA certification

Perform other duties as assigned

Skills and Qualifications

Current Certified Nursing Assistant (CNA) certification in accordance with state law

Must be at least 18 years of age

Long term care experience preferred

Current CPR certification required

Ability to read, write, and communicate effectively in English

Ability to lift up to 100 pounds and assist residents with physical mobility needs
